Master tuning

In order to adapt the C-720 pitch to that of another instru- ment, you can adjust the pitch. Standard tuning is A4 = 440 Hz.

2.Use the +/YES and -/NO button to select a different tun- ing.

Note: If you enter editing later, you might see a different edit

page instead of the first one. Use the SCROLL button to reach it.

1.After having kept the EDIT button pressed, the Master Tune page will appear:

Master Tune

3

440.0 Hz

 

 

 

Setting

Tuning

 

 

415 ~ -439.5

Lower tuning. The lowest value corresponds to

 

about -100 cents (one semitone) from the stan-

 

dard tuning.

 

 

440

Standard tuning

440.5~ 465 Higher tuning. The highest value corresponds to about +100 cents (one semitone) over the stan- dard tuning.

3.Press the EXIT button to return to the Main or Song Play page and save the changes (see “Exit from the Global edit

mode” on page 47), or the SCROLL button to go to the next edit page (see below).

Brilliance

Brilliance is the sound’s brightness. You can set an overall in- crease or decrease of brilliance.

This is the same parameter you can change with the BRIL- LIANCE button (see page 17). However, contrary to the but- ton, these changes can be memorized, and are preserved even when turning the instrument off.

Note: Brilliance changes can be recorded into a song. If you lat- er change them again, values recorded in the song are left un- changed.

1.After having kept the EDIT button pressed, use the

SCROLL button to show the Brilliance page. As an al- ternative, press the BRILLIANCE button to immediately access the Brilliance page:

Brilliance 4

Normal

After having chosen a brilliance value different than Nor- mal, the BRILLIANCE indicator will turn on.

2.Use the +/YES and -/NO button to change the brilliance. The following table lists the available settings.

Setting

Brilliance

 

 

Very Mellow, Mellow

The sound becomes darker.

 

 

Normal

Normal tone.

 

 

Bright, Very Bright

The sound becomes brighter.

 

 

3.Press the EXIT button to return to the Main or Song Play page and save the changes (see “Exit from the Global edit

mode” on page 47), or the SCROLL button to go to the next edit page (see below).

Default split point

You can set a default split point, that will be automatically re- called each time you press the SPLIT button when playing sounds.

Note: The split point may be different from the default split point, if you change it after turning the instrument on. Also, it may vary when choosing a performance with two sounds in Split mode. The last selected split point remains selected, until you turn the instrument off.

1.After having kept the EDIT button pressed, use the

SCROLL button to show the Split Point page:

Split Point

5

F#3

 

 

 

2.Use the +/YES and -/NO button to change the split point. When you change this value, if you are in Split mode the current split point is also changed.

3.Press the EXIT button to return to the Main or Song Play page and save the changes (see “Exit from the Global edit

mode” on page 47), or the SCROLL button to go to the next edit page (see below).
